在数字化时代,定位与导航技术已经渗透到我们生活的方方面面。从智能手机到自动驾驶汽车,从无人机到虚拟现实,精准的定位与导航能力是这些技术的核心。而SLAM(Simultaneous Localization and Mapping,即同时定位与建图)技术,正是实现这一目标的关键。本文将带您深入了解SLAM技术,特别是如何利用雷霆照片实现精准定位与导航。
SLAM技术概述
SLAM技术是一种在未知环境中,通过传感器获取数据,同时完成自身定位和地图构建的技术。它广泛应用于机器人、无人机、自动驾驶等领域。SLAM技术的核心挑战在于如何在有限的数据下,快速、准确地完成定位和地图构建。
雷霆照片与SLAM技术
雷霆照片,即利用无人机搭载的高清相机拍摄的照片,因其分辨率高、信息丰富等特点,在SLAM技术中有着广泛的应用。以下是利用雷霆照片实现精准定位与导航的几个关键步骤:
1. 图像预处理
在利用雷霆照片进行SLAM之前,需要对图像进行预处理。预处理步骤包括:
- 图像去噪:去除图像中的噪声,提高图像质量。
- 图像配准:将多张图像进行拼接,形成一幅全景图像。
- 特征提取:从图像中提取关键点,为后续匹配提供基础。
2. 特征匹配
特征匹配是SLAM技术中的关键步骤,其目的是在相邻图像之间找到对应的关键点。常见的特征匹配算法包括:
- SIFT(Scale-Invariant Feature Transform):一种在图像中提取关键点的算法,具有尺度不变性。
- SURF(Speeded Up Robust Features):与SIFT类似,但计算速度更快。
- ORB(Oriented FAST and Rotated BRIEF):一种在性能和速度之间取得平衡的特征提取算法。
3. 相机位姿估计
相机位姿估计是指根据特征匹配结果,计算出相机在相邻图像之间的位姿变化。常用的算法包括:
- PnP(Perspective-n-Point)算法:通过多个已知点计算出相机的位姿。
- ** bundle adjustment**:通过优化相机位姿和特征点的匹配关系,提高定位精度。
4. 地图构建
在完成相机位姿估计后,可以将相邻图像中的关键点连接起来,形成一幅三维地图。常见的地图构建方法包括:
- 稀疏地图:只记录关键点的位置和连接关系。
- 稠密地图:记录整个场景的三维信息。
5. 定位与导航
在完成地图构建后,可以通过匹配当前图像中的关键点与地图中的点,实现实时定位。同时,根据地图信息,可以规划出最优路径,实现导航。
总结
SLAM技术利用雷霆照片等高分辨率图像,实现了在未知环境中的精准定位与导航。本文从图像预处理、特征匹配、相机位姿估计、地图构建和定位与导航等方面,对SLAM技术进行了详细介绍。随着技术的不断发展,SLAM技术将在更多领域发挥重要作用。